Which action is most appropriate for the nurse to take when a patient with a chronic wound voices the preference of taking herbs to boost immunity rather than prescribed antibiotics?


A) Instruct the patient about the rationale for antibiotic use to treat infection.
B) Remind the patient that the infection has not cleared with herbal treatment.
C) Tell the patient that research shows that herbs are not effective in treating infection.
D) Determine how the patient feels about using antibiotics in addition to herbal products.
